Core Elements of AI Budget Tracking
Data Collection Systems
AI budget tracking pulls data from various marketing channels into one place. This is done through methods like custom APIs, direct platform integrations, or automated uploads using tools like Google Sheets or CSV files. By standardizing data formats and ensuring regular updates, companies create a reliable foundation for AI to analyze marketing spend. This centralized approach makes it easier for AI tools to deliver accurate insights.
AI Analysis Tools
AI tools rely on algorithms to identify spending trends and predict outcomes. Here are some common technologies and their roles:
Technology | Purpose | Benefit |
---|---|---|
Marketing Mix Modeling (MMM) | Evaluates channel performance and spending | Identifies revenue contributions by channel |
Predictive Lifetime Value (pLTV) | Assesses early campaign outcomes | Forecasts customer value for better budget planning |
Predictive Events Analysis | Analyzes customer behavior trends | Helps fine-tune campaigns for better results |
These tools provide actionable insights that support real-time decision-making.

Common Problems and Solutions
Data Quality Issues
Most businesses (96%) begin with insufficient training data, while 66% encounter dataset errors or biases. Cleaning a dataset of 100,000 samples can take 80–160 hours .

Strategic Limitations
AI performs well with tactical decisions but struggles with long-term planning . To overcome this:
- Split budgeting into tactical tasks (AI-led) and strategic tasks (human-led)
- Build strong reporting systems to track performance
- Keep an eye on external factors like seasonal trends and competitor actions
